Let’s start the night off by taking look back over the three biggest stories of Thursday, May 1, 2025.
- Dan Argueta retires after six fights in the Octagon: If you haven’t seen it, Argueta vs. Turcios was an absolute banger, and a re-watch would be a worthy show of respect.
- Bo Nickal vs. Reinier de Ridder preview, prediction: Sadly, the heart and the brain are separate on my prediction here. De Ridder will have openings, but I’m guessing he’s too awkward to take advantage.
- Fans really want de Ridder to win though: It’s genuinely wild how unanimously the MMA community has sided against one of the sport’s best prospects. Fighters have done much worse and been rewarded with far less hate, but also … I get it.
